2021-08-04 22:30:35

by Alex Elder

[permalink] [raw]
Subject: [PATCH 4/4] arm64: dts: qcom: sm8350: fix IPA interconnects

There should only be two interconnects defined for IPA on the
QUalcomm SM8350 SoC. The names should also match those specified by
the IPA Device Tree binding.

Signed-off-by: Alex Elder <[email protected]>
---
arch/arm64/boot/dts/qcom/sm8350.dtsi | 8 +++-----
1 file changed, 3 insertions(+), 5 deletions(-)

diff --git a/arch/arm64/boot/dts/qcom/sm8350.dtsi b/arch/arm64/boot/dts/qcom/sm8350.dtsi
index a631d58166b1c..01f60a3bd1c14 100644
--- a/arch/arm64/boot/dts/qcom/sm8350.dtsi
+++ b/arch/arm64/boot/dts/qcom/sm8350.dtsi
@@ -666,12 +666,10 @@ ipa: ipa@1e40000 {
clocks = <&rpmhcc RPMH_IPA_CLK>;
clock-names = "core";

- interconnects = <&aggre2_noc MASTER_IPA &gem_noc SLAVE_LLCC>,
- <&mc_virt MASTER_LLCC &mc_virt SLAVE_EBI1>,
+ interconnects = <&aggre2_noc MASTER_IPA &mc_virt SLAVE_EBI1>,
<&gem_noc MASTER_APPSS_PROC &config_noc SLAVE_IPA_CFG>;
- interconnect-names = "ipa_to_llcc",
- "llcc_to_ebi1",
- "appss_to_ipa";
+ interconnect-names = "memory",
+ "config";

qcom,smem-states = <&ipa_smp2p_out 0>,
<&ipa_smp2p_out 1>;
--
2.27.0


2021-08-10 16:46:24

by Georgi Djakov

[permalink] [raw]
Subject: Re: [PATCH 4/4] arm64: dts: qcom: sm8350: fix IPA interconnects

On 5.08.21 0:02, Alex Elder wrote:
> There should only be two interconnects defined for IPA on the
> QUalcomm SM8350 SoC. The names should also match those specified by
> the IPA Device Tree binding.
>
> Signed-off-by: Alex Elder <[email protected]>

Acked-by: Georgi Djakov <[email protected]>

> ---
> arch/arm64/boot/dts/qcom/sm8350.dtsi | 8 +++-----
> 1 file changed, 3 insertions(+), 5 deletions(-)
>
> diff --git a/arch/arm64/boot/dts/qcom/sm8350.dtsi b/arch/arm64/boot/dts/qcom/sm8350.dtsi
> index a631d58166b1c..01f60a3bd1c14 100644
> --- a/arch/arm64/boot/dts/qcom/sm8350.dtsi
> +++ b/arch/arm64/boot/dts/qcom/sm8350.dtsi
> @@ -666,12 +666,10 @@ ipa: ipa@1e40000 {
> clocks = <&rpmhcc RPMH_IPA_CLK>;
> clock-names = "core";
>
> - interconnects = <&aggre2_noc MASTER_IPA &gem_noc SLAVE_LLCC>,
> - <&mc_virt MASTER_LLCC &mc_virt SLAVE_EBI1>,
> + interconnects = <&aggre2_noc MASTER_IPA &mc_virt SLAVE_EBI1>,
> <&gem_noc MASTER_APPSS_PROC &config_noc SLAVE_IPA_CFG>;
> - interconnect-names = "ipa_to_llcc",
> - "llcc_to_ebi1",
> - "appss_to_ipa";
> + interconnect-names = "memory",
> + "config";
>
> qcom,smem-states = <&ipa_smp2p_out 0>,
> <&ipa_smp2p_out 1>;
>